Venture Plastics Purchases New 950-Ton Injection Molding Press



Photo Caption: The new Nissei equipment will be the second large 950-ton machine at the Venture Plastics Southwest location in El Paso, TX

Venture Plastics, Inc., a full-service ISO 9001:2015, IATF 16949 certified custom thermoplastics injection molder with processing facilities in Newton Falls, OH, and El Paso, TX, continues to meet customer demand with new equipment.

A new FVX 860 (950-ton) Nissei injection molding press will be installed at the Southwest Venture Plastics, LLC plant in El Paso, TX, to support customers in the Southwestern portions of the U.S. and in Central America. This will join another FVX 860 Nissei machine that was added to the plant in 2013.

This new addition is the third Nissei press added between both Venture Plastics, Inc. facilities in the last year. The Newton Falls, OH, plant installed a 1,440-ton Nissei in late 2017 and a 185-ton Nissei machine was added in May 2018.

Between the two facilities Venture Plastics, Inc. offers a range of injection molding machines (55 ton to 1,440 ton) capable of serving a diversified customer base-including, but not limited to: industrial, consumer, major appliance, truck, agriculture, automotive, fuel delivery and communication markets.
